The magic words Ash must use to claim the Book of the Dead are "Clatto Verata Nicto" - a reference to "Klaatu, Barada, Nikto", the words used to command the robot Gort in The Day the Earth Stood Still (1951).

The third--and presumably last--of the Evil Dead movies finds Ash Williams(B-movie supreme ruler Bruce Campbell in full froth)somehow transported(along with his broken down car)in Medieval England,about to do battle,once again,with the undead,with the aid of(among other things) his "boom stick" and his chainsaw. While being a strange man in a strange land,he romances plucky lass Sheila(Embeth Davitz,pre-Schindler's List) and aiding the reluctant natives(among them Ian Abercrombie,MArcus Gilbert and Richard Groce).
To me(and I suspect I am not alone on this),one of the neat things about this film is that it moves at such a rip-roaring pace that one has little time to catch their breath or even add up the absurdity of the story. But,to quote another commenter,Who cares? This offering,which pretty much eschews the original Evil Dead's Horror premise,and capitalizes on more of the crazed,feverish pacing of Evil Dead 2,seems content to offer large doses of humor mixed with raucous violence and only the thinnest character exposition. Bully for director/co-writer Sam Raimi,co-writer Ivan Raimi and company on this! This is a great "palate-cleanser" of a movie and is a solid party film(among other occasions),whether you're fans of Campbell,Raimi,berserker action films,comedies or all four.
